命令行参数怎么输入?一文读懂命令行参数的输入方法与应用
命令行参数怎么输入?一文读懂命令行参数的输入方法与应用
在日常的计算机操作中,命令行参数是我们经常会遇到的概念。无论你是程序员、系统管理员还是普通用户,了解如何输入命令行参数都能够大大提高你的工作效率。本文将详细介绍命令行参数的输入方法,并列举一些常见的应用场景。
什么是命令行参数?
命令行参数(Command Line Arguments)是指在执行命令行程序时,传递给程序的参数。这些参数通常用于修改程序的行为或提供必要的信息。它们可以是文件名、选项、开关等。
如何输入命令行参数?
-
基本格式:
- 命令行参数通常在命令之后以空格分隔输入。例如:
ls -l /home/user
这里,
ls
是命令,-l
和/home/user
是参数。
- 命令行参数通常在命令之后以空格分隔输入。例如:
-
短选项和长选项:
- 短选项通常是一个连字符(
-
)后跟一个字母,如-l
。 - 长选项通常是两个连字符(
--
)后跟单词或短语,如--help
。
- 短选项通常是一个连字符(
-
参数组合:
- 可以将多个短选项组合在一起,如:
ls -la
- 长选项通常不能组合,但可以单独使用:
cp --recursive --verbose source destination
- 可以将多个短选项组合在一起,如:
-
带参数的选项:
- 有些选项需要额外的参数,如:
cp -r source destination
这里,
-r
是选项,source
和destination
是其参数。
- 有些选项需要额外的参数,如:
常见应用场景
-
文件操作:
cp
(复制文件):cp source_file destination_file
mv
(移动或重命名文件):mv old_name new_name
-
文本处理:
grep
(搜索文本):grep "pattern" file.txt
sed
(流编辑器):sed 's/old/new/g' file.txt
-
系统管理:
ps
(查看进程):ps aux
kill
(终止进程):kill -9 PID
-
网络操作:
ping
(测试网络连通性):ping -c 4 google.com
wget
(下载文件):wget -O output_file url
注意事项
- 安全性:在输入命令行参数时,避免泄露敏感信息,如密码等。
- 语法正确性:确保参数的格式和顺序正确,否则可能导致命令执行失败。
- 权限:某些命令需要管理员权限(如
sudo
),请谨慎使用。
总结
了解命令行参数怎么输入不仅能提高你的工作效率,还能让你更好地理解和控制计算机系统。无论是简单的文件操作还是复杂的系统管理,命令行参数都是不可或缺的工具。希望本文能帮助你掌握这些基本技能,并在实际操作中灵活运用。
通过本文的介绍,相信你已经对命令行参数有了更深入的了解。无论你是初学者还是经验丰富的用户,掌握这些技巧都将使你的计算机操作更加得心应手。